Comment intégrer un bot de trading dans un serveur Discord en 2025 ? Guide complet
Vous souhaitez automatiser vos transactions ou offrir des fonctionnalités de trading à votre communauté Discord ? Découvrez comment intégrer un bot de trading dans votre serveur en quelques étapes simples. Que vous soyez un trader débutant ou un administrateur expérimenté, ce guide vous explique tout : des prérequis techniques aux meilleures pratiques pour éviter les erreurs courantes. Avec l’essor des cryptomonnaies et des marchés financiers, les bots de trading Discord deviennent incontournables pour les communautés engagées. Prêt à booster votre serveur ? Suivez le guide !
Pourquoi intégrer un bot de trading dans votre serveur Discord ?
Les serveurs Discord dédiés au trading, aux cryptomonnaies ou aux marchés financiers explosent en popularité depuis 2023. Ces espaces permettent aux membres d’échanger des analyses, des signaux et des stratégies en temps réel. Un bot de trading y ajoute une dimension automatisée : suivi des cours, alertes de prix, exécution d’ordres, ou même simulations de portefeuille. Contrairement aux groupes Telegram ou aux forums classiques, Discord offre une interface intuitive et des fonctionnalités vocales pour les discussions en direct.
Les raisons d’intégrer un tel bot sont multiples : gagner du temps en automatisant les tâches répétitives, attirer une communauté plus technique, ou proposer des outils exclusifs à vos abonnés premium. Des projets comme CryptoBot ou TradingView Alerts sont devenus des références, mais il existe des alternatives pour tous les budgets. Avant de vous lancer, vérifiez la légalité des bots dans votre pays, surtout s’ils interagissent avec des plateformes comme Binance ou Kraken.
Comment fonctionne un bot de trading Discord ?
Un bot de trading Discord agit comme un intermédiaire entre votre serveur et une API de trading (comme Binance, Bybit, ou TradingView). Il peut exécuter plusieurs types de commandes selon les modules installés. Voici les fonctionnalités les plus courantes :
- Suivi des prix en temps réel : Le bot affiche les cours des cryptomonnaies ou actions via des commandes comme !price BTC ou !ticker ETH. Certains bots intègrent des graphiques ASCII pour une visualisation rapide.
- Alertes de prix personnalisables : Configurez des notifications quand un actif atteint un seuil (ex : !alert BTC 50000). Les alertes peuvent être envoyées en privé ou dans un canal dédié.
- Exécution d’ordres (pour les bots avancés) : Certains bots connectés à des APIs de trading permettent d’acheter/vendre via des commandes Discord, comme !buy BTC 0.1. Attention, cette fonctionnalité nécessite des clés API sécurisées.
- Simulations de portefeuille : Les membres peuvent suivre la performance de leurs "faux investissements" avec des commandes comme !portfolio, idéales pour les débutants.
- Analyse technique intégrée : Certains bots affichent des indicateurs comme le RSI ou les moyennes mobiles via des graphiques générés automatiquement.
Pour fonctionner, le bot a besoin d’un token Discord (obtenu via le Developer Portal) et, selon ses fonctionnalités, d’une clé API d’un exchange. La plupart des bots open-source (comme Freqtrade ou ProfitTrailer) nécessitent une installation sur un serveur VPS pour une disponibilité 24/7.
Étapes détaillées pour intégrer un bot de trading Discord
Voici une méthode pas à pas, adaptée aux débutants comme aux utilisateurs avancés. Nous utiliserons l’exemple d’un bot populaire : CryptoBot (gratuit) et TradingView Alerts (pour les alertes avancées).
- Étape 1 : Préparer votre serveur Discord
- Créez un rôle dédié pour le bot (ex : "TradingBot") avec les permissions nécessaires : Lire les messages, Envoyer des messages, Gérer les webhooks.
- Activez le mode développeur dans les paramètres de votre compte Discord (pour accéder aux IDs des canaux).
- Choisissez un canal dédié aux commandes du bot (ex : #📊-trading) pour éviter le spam.
- Étape 2 : Créer un bot Discord
- Rendez-vous sur le Portail Développeur Discord et cliquez sur New Application.
- Donnez un nom à votre bot (ex : "MyTradingBot") et allez dans l’onglet Bot pour générer un token (à conserver précieusement !).
- Dans l’onglet OAuth2, cochez les permissions nécessaires (ex : Send Messages, Read Message History) et générez une URL d’invitation. Collez-la dans votre navigateur pour ajouter le bot à votre serveur.
- Étape 3 : Configurer le bot avec une API de trading
- Pour un bot simple comme CryptoBot, rendez-vous sur son documentation officielle et suivez les instructions pour lier votre compte Binance ou CoinGecko.
- Pour des fonctionnalités avancées (ex : exécution d’ordres), utilisez un bot comme Freqtrade. Installez-le sur un VPS (comme DigitalOcean ou Oracle Cloud) avec Python et configurez le fichier config.json avec vos clés API.
- Testez les commandes de base dans votre serveur (ex : !help pour lister les fonctionnalités).
- Étape 4 : Personnaliser les commandes et les alertes
- Modifiez les réponses du bot via son fichier de configuration ou son tableau de bord (pour les bots premium). Par exemple, ajoutez des emojis ou des couleurs pour les alertes : !alert BTC 50000 🚨.
- Pour les alertes TradingView, liez votre compte TradingView à Discord via un webhook. Dans TradingView, créez une alerte et collez l’URL du webhook Discord dans le champ "Webhook URL".
- Utilisez des variables pour dynamiser les messages, comme {symbol} {price} {change}% dans les notifications.
- Étape 5 : Sécuriser et optimiser le bot
- Ne partagez jamais votre token Discord ou vos clés API en public. Utilisez des variables d’environnement (.env) pour les stocker.
- Limitez l’accès aux commandes sensibles (ex : !trade) à un rôle spécifique (ex : "Modérateur Trading").
- Pour éviter les abus, configurez des limites de requêtes (rate limits) dans le code du bot ou via un module comme discord.py.
- Sauvegardez régulièrement la configuration du bot et les données de trading (pour les bots comme Freqtrade).
Astuces pour maximiser l’engagement autour de votre bot
Un bot de trading ne sert à rien s’il n’est pas utilisé ! Voici des conseils pour en faire un atout majeur pour votre communauté :
- Créez un tutoriel vidéo ou un guide écrit : Beaucoup d’utilisateurs abandonnent par manque de compréhension. Montrez comment utiliser les commandes via une vidéo YouTube ou un post épinglé dans votre serveur.
- Organisez des sessions live : Utilisez des salons vocaux pour expliquer les stratégies ou analyser les marchés en direct. Les membres apprécieront l’interaction humaine derrière le bot.
- Proposez des défis de trading : Lancez un concours mensuel où les participants doivent utiliser le bot pour simuler des trades. Le gagnant (celui avec le meilleur rendement) reçoit un badge ou un rôle spécial sur le serveur.
- Intégrez des fonctionnalités sociales : Ajoutez un système de points (via Dyno Bot ou MEE6) pour récompenser les membres actifs. Par exemple, chaque commande !price donne 1 point échangeable contre des avantages.
- Personnalisez les réponses du bot : Remplacez les messages génériques par des réponses humoristiques ou des memes (ex : "BTC à 50k ? T’as plus de chances de gagner au Loto 🎲"). Cela rend l’expérience plus conviviale.
- Surveillez les performances : Utilisez des outils comme Google Analytics (pour les liens de votre serveur) ou Discord Insights pour voir quelles commandes sont les plus utilisées. Supprimez celles qui ne servent à rien.
- Collaborez avec des influenceurs crypto : Proposez à des streamers ou YouTubeurs crypto de tester votre bot sur leur serveur en échange de visibilité. Cela peut attirer des centaines de nouveaux membres.
Où trouver des bots de trading Discord et rejoindre des communautés ?
Que vous cherchiez un bot clé en main ou des ressources pour en créer un, voici les meilleures plateformes et communautés pour vous aider :
- Bibliothèques et bots open-source :
- CCXT : Une bibliothèque Python/JavaScript pour interagir avec +100 exchanges (Binance, Kraken, etc.). Idéale pour créer votre propre bot.
- Freqtrade : Un bot de trading algorithmique open-source avec backtesting et optimisation. Parfait pour les stratégies automatisées.
- CryptoSignal : Un bot qui envoie des signaux d’achat/vente basés sur l’analyse technique.
- Bots premium et services clés en main :
- CryptoBot : Un bot tout-en-un avec suivi de prix, alertes et portefeuille. Version gratuite disponible.
- TradingView Alerts : Intégrez vos alertes TradingView directement dans Discord via webhooks.
- ProfitTrailer : Un bot de trading crypto pour Binance et Bybit, avec interface graphique et stratégies prédéfinies.
- Communautés et forums :
- Serveur Discord "Cryptocurrency" : +500k membres, avec des salons dédiés aux bots de trading.